What is the difference between Contract Bachelor Electrical Engineering vs Contract Electrical Technician?

AspectContract Bachelor Electrical EngineeringContract Electrical Technician
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Electrical EngineeringDiploma or technical certification in electrical technology
Work EnvironmentDesign, planning, project management, and oversightInstallation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of electrical systems
Employer & Industry UsageEngineering firms, construction, manufacturingConstruction companies, maintenance services, industrial plants

Contract Bachelor Electrical Engineering professionals typically focus on design, analysis, and project management, requiring a degree. In contrast, Contract Electrical Technicians handle hands-on installation and maintenance tasks with technical certifications. Both roles are essential in electrical projects but differ in scope, responsibilities, and qualifications.

What can I do with a contract bachelor electrical engineering?

A contract bachelor electrical engineer can work on designing, testing, and maintaining electrical systems in various industries such as manufacturing, energy, or telecommunications. These roles often require knowledge of circuit design, electrical codes, and tools like AutoCAD or MATLAB, and may involve project-based work with flexible schedules. Contract positions can provide experience and opportunities to specialize in areas like power systems, control systems, or electronics.

Job description

TheElectrical Engineering Technicianassists NAVFAC WASH with performance of electrical engineering statement of work development. TheElectrical Engineering Technicianis familiar with both Design-Bid-Build and Design-Build, delivery methods for projects, and should have the ability to estimate design/construction efforts of scopes of works and assist the Contracting Officer in the negotiations of statements of work with the General Contractor. TheElectrical Engineering Techniciancan review contractor submittals and respond to requests for information (RFI's).

Responsibilities
  • Responsibleforproviding guidance and consultation for electrical power distribution, lighting, and telecommunications systems.
  • Responsibleforperforming inspections and developing studies, designs, construction documents.
  • Perform on-site field inspections of on-going construction projects.
  • Assisttheconstruction manager in monitoring the status of construction progress for quality and timeliness of construction on contracts that involve technically complex electrical system aspects.
  • Review plans and specifications for complex electrical systems in such facilities as hospitals, power plants, geothermal heat, plating shop projects and other sophisticated projects involving complex and highly technical electrical equipment and systems.
  • Review and recommend approval of shop drawings, samples of materials and components, catalog information, and certificates of compliance.
  • Other duties as assigned
Qualifications
  • High school diploma or GED is required.
  • 5+ years of experience is required in the field of designing and producing electrical facility design drawings and specifications.
  • Background check required with the ability to obtain an interim secret or secret clearance, prior to hire and start.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
  • Certifiedas a Master Electrician is a plus.
  • Substantial knowledge and practical application of electrical design concepts, theories, principles, practices, and techniques necessary to plan, design, construct, and maintain a wide range of shore based engineering projects.
  • Havea thorough knowledge of electrical systems, which include progressively difficult substantial experience in this filed.
  • Ability to function independently, interpreting, adapting, and supplementing this knowledge as necessary to complete the task, test, or project.
  • Knowledgeof DoD and Navy guide specifications, criteria and policy, industry codes and standards, and standard practices as related to electrical engineering design including the NFPA 70 (National Electrical Code), IEEE C2 (National Electrical Safety Code), and the International Building Code.
  • Knowledge of Design-Bid-Build (DBB) and Design-Build (DB) Contracts.
